7 minutes ago, Jimmy Keller said:

Thanks smurf .We are about the same in starting weight .I see you hd your surgery already how was first couple days?

Yes! I went and followed you on here, because I saw we were in the same starting weight range. :)

Not gonna lie. The day-of and the day-after I was pretty miserable. Sore where my stomach is and near the incision sites, but the worst part was having LOTS of gas pains in my back! I started taking the powdered mirolax in some flavored water the day after surgery, and chewed up a few gas-x pills, and that seemed to help a lot. Take the Tylenol with codeine or whatever it is they give you!! I only needed it for 3 days, but it did help a TON!

By 3-4 days out, i'm feeling like myself again. It's an adjustment getting used to sipping liquids. It took me a couple of days to figure out my limit; more than 2 small sips at a time and it hurts. My wife picked up some warm beef pho broth today and it's going down just fine. The Protein Shakes I liked before surgery taste nasty now, so I've got to figure out if there's something else that does taste good.

Try not to stress. It's a short surgery, and will be over before you know it. You'll do great!
